class pingen_task(orm.Model):
""" A pingen task is the state of the synchronization of
an attachment with pingen.com
It stores the configuration and the current state of the synchronization.
It also serves as a queue of documents to push to pingen.com
"""
_name = 'pingen.task'
_inherits = {'ir.attachment': 'attachment_id'}
_columns = {
'attachment_id': fields.many2one(
'ir.attachment', 'Document', required=True, ondelete='cascade'),
'state': fields.selection(
[('pending', 'Pending'),
('pushed', 'Pushed'),
('error', 'Error'),
('canceled', 'Canceled')],
string='State', readonly=True, required=True),
'config': fields.text('Configuration (tmp)'),
'date': fields.datetime('Creation Date'),
'push_date': fields.datetime('Pushed Date'),
'send': fields.boolean(
'Send',
help="Defines if a document is merely uploaed or also sent"),
'speed': fields.selection(
[(1, 'Priority'), (2, 'Economy')],
'Speed',
help="Defines the sending speed if the document is automatically sent"),
'color': fields.selection( [(0, 'B/W'), (1, 'Color')], 'Type of print'),
'last_error_code': fields.integer('Error Code', readonly=True),
'last_error_message': fields.text('Error Message', readonly=True),
'pingen_id': fields.integer('Pingen ID'),
}
_defaults = {
'state': 'pending',
}
_sql_constraints = [
('pingen_task_attachment_uniq',
'unique (attachment_id)',
'Only one Pingen task is allowed per attachment.'),
]
def _push_to_pingen(self, cr, uid, task_id, context=None):
""" Push a document to pingen.com
"""
success = False
push_url = urlparse.urljoin(BASE_URL, 'document/upload')
auth = {'token': TOKEN}
config = {
'send': False,
'speed': 2,
'color': 1,
}
task = self.browse(cr, uid, task_id, context=context)
if task.type == 'binary':
decoded_document = base64.decodestring(task.datas)
else:
url_resp = requests.get(task.url)
if url_resp.status_code != 200:
task.write({'last_error_code': False,
'last_error_message': "%s" % req.error,
'state': 'error'},
context=context)
return False
decoded_document = requests.content
document = {'file': (task.datas_fname, StringIO(decoded_document))}
try:
# TODO extract
req = requests.post(
push_url,
params=auth,
data=config,
files=document,
# verify = False required for staging environment
verify=False)
req.raise_for_status()
except (requests.HTTPError,
requests.Timeout,
requests.ConnectionError) as e:
msg = ('%s Message: %s. \n'
'It occured when pushing the Pingen Task %s to pingen.com. \n'
'It will be retried later.' % (e.__doc__, e, task.id))
_logger.error(msg)
task.write(
{'last_error_code': False,
'last_error_message': msg,
'state': 'error'},
context=context)
else:
response = req.json
if response['error']:
task.write(
{'last_error_code': response['errorcode'],
'last_error_message': 'Error from pingen.com: %s' % response['errormessage'],
'state': 'error'},
context=context)
else:
task.write(
{'last_error_code': False,
'last_error_message': False,
'state': 'pushed',
'pingen_id': response['id'],},
context=context)
_logger.info('Pingen Task %s pushed to pingen.com.' % task.id)
success = True
return success
def push_to_pingen(self, cr, uid, ids, context=None):
""" Push a document to pingen.com
Wrapper method for multiple ids (when triggered from button)
"""
for task_id in ids:
self._push_to_pingen(cr, uid, task_id, context=context)
return True
